Introduction

AI Translation

GP8102S/GP8102SL is a PWM-to-analog signal converter, functioning equivalently to a DAC with PWM input and analog signal output. The device achieves a typical output current linearity of 0.1%.

Features

AI Translation
  • Linearly converts PWM input signals with 0% to 100% duty cycle to current signal output; with a suitable sampling resistor Rs=100Ω, outputs 0–25mA analog current.
  • GP8102S output current: IOUT = DPWM × 5V / Rs, where DPWM is the high-level duty cycle of the input PWM signal and Rs is the sampling resistor.
  • GP8102SL output current: IOUT = DPWM × 2.5V / Rs, where DPWM is the high-level duty cycle of the input PWM signal and Rs is the sampling resistor.
  • Input signal duty cycle range: 0% to 100%.
  • Input PWM signal frequency range: 50Hz to 50KHz.
  • Input PWM signal high-level voltage: 2.7V to 5.5V.
  • Output current linearity error: 0.1% typical.
  • Supply voltage: 9V to 36V.
  • Power consumption: < 1mA.
  • Start-up time: < 2ms.
  • Operating temperature: -40°C to 85°C.
